Welcome to my GitHub!
I'm a full stack developer focused on building modular, diagnostics-first, event sourcing and maintainable platforms.
My work centers on modular applications, profile-aware configuration, and secure orchestration - always designed with clarity and future maintainers in mind.
I believe architecture should empower. Whether building platforms in diffrent languages (C#/Java) or designing audit-friendly CQRS flows, I strive for transparency, traceability, and composability. Every artifact is an opportunity to make onboarding easier and diagnostics sharper.
- π Iβm currently working on a modular mix of .NET Core and Next.JS platform, retrofitting entities for audit trails, and building async-ready orchestration layers.
- π± Iβm currently learning advanced temporal filtering strategies, edge-device diagnostics, and Raspberry Pi orchestration.
- π― Iβm looking to collaborate on diagnostics-first platforms, secure REST APIs, and event-driven systems with auditability.
- π¬ Ask me about CQRS, Spring Boot diagnostics, async service orchestration, or cross-language maintainability.
- π Pronouns: he/him
β‘ Fun fact: Iβm an avid archer and licensed archery coach - precision and patience in the field mirror how I approach architecture. I also love tinkering with Raspberry Pi setups to explore lightweight orchestration and edge diagnostics.
Languages & Frameworks: C#, .NET Core, Java 21+, Spring Boot, NodeJs, JavaScript, TypeScript, React, Angular, SCSS, CSS, HTML, ChartJS
Databases: MSSQL, PostgreSQL, MySQL, H2DB
Tools & Platforms: Visual Studio, VS Code, Git, Jira, Confluence, Azure Portal, MSSQL Studio, Postman, PowerShell, Browser DevTools
Other: CI/CD, SFTP, iText7, JWT, NextJS, TailwindCSS, XML, JSON
Here are a few recent projects (under NDA) that reflect my experience:
- Developed interfaces to frontend and third-party applications and libraries
- Developement with poly repo artifact achitecture
- Implemented gRPC communication between AGV and HMI with a Core middle layer inbetween
- Migrated databases and report generation (PDFs from HTML)
- Telemetry dashboard rendered graphs with ChartJS and Grids
- Developed algorithms for sensor and actor reading and control
- Conducted code reviews, tests, and documentation
- Implementation of self-made Code Pattern Tooling for easier code-readability and pipelining sync / async
- Building CI/CD Pipeline in Azure DevOps
- Developed interfaces to frontend and third-party applications and libraries
- Implementation of self-made Idiom for easier code-readability
- Implementation of QR-Code generation and scanning
- Implementation WebSocket/Rest-API communication between Frontend and Backend steering the PLC-device over OPC UA
- Telemetry and separated user dashboard
- Integration of PLC-programmed maschine
- Conducted code reviews, tests, and documentation
- Building CI/CD Pipeline in Azure DevOps
- Developed interfaces to frontend and third-party applications
- Implemented SSO, document archive, and JWT-based authorization
- Built user portals with two-factor authentication
- Migrated databases and generated PDFs from HTML using iText7
- Created email templates and rendered graphs with ChartJS
- Developed algorithms for financial calculations based on XML input
- Conducted code reviews, tests, and documentation
- Migrated tech stack and extended platform functionality
- Implemented DDD, CQRS, and Event Sourcing
- Delivered new features and maintained documentation
- Developed configurable automation modules
- Integrated OCR software and document archiving
- Led code reviews and customer discussions
- Built responsive UI for property valuation
- Integrated location services and third-party APIs
- Designed user flows, validation, and accessibility features
If you're passionate about maintainable architecture, diagnostics, secure orchestration, or even archery Iβd love to connect. Whether it's a quick chat or a deep dive into design patterns, Iβm here to learn, share, and grow.
βMichael is a resilient, future-focused architect who treats every technical artifact as an opportunity for clarity and improvement.β
Thanks for visiting π
